Uttar Pradesh Mobilizes Relief Efforts After Deadly Storms

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ath orders immediate aid, damage assessments, and crop protection following severe weather that claimed multiple lives.

Overview

  •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ath directed district officials to expedite relief work, including financial compensation for life and livestock losses, and medical care for the injured.
  • A sudden rain, hail, and dust storm on April 17 caused around a dozen fatalities and injuries across multiple districts in Uttar Pradesh, with significant damage reported.
  • Authorities are conducting rapid surveys to assess crop losses and infrastructure damage, with reports to be submitted for further government action.
  • Special measures have been ordered to prevent waterlogging through drainage work and to safeguard wheat stocks during the ongoing procurement season.
  • The Chief Minister reassured residents that their safety is the government’s top priority and emphasized swift action to protect lives, property, and agricultural assets.
